16 WOMEN ARRESTED IN ANTI-VICE OPERATION AT MASSAGE, RESIDENTIAL & COMMERCIAL UNITS

According to the Police media release, a total of 35 men and women, aged 25 to 82, for various offences following a series of enforcement operations conducted across five days between 25 to 29 May 2022.

The operation was conducted by Tanglin Police Division gainst massage establishment outlets and vice activities.

Illegal Gambling and Vice at Balestier

In the operation against illegal gambling along Balestier Road and Toa Payoh Lorong 4, 16 men and three women were investigated for offences under the Common Gaming Houses Act 1961 and Betting Act 1960.

More than $6,000 in cash and gambling-related paraphernalia were seized.

The arrest of eight female subjects for offences under the Women’s Charter 1961 in an unlicensed massage establishment along Balestier Road.

Massage – Upp Thomson and Mackenzie Road

Seven commercial units and two private residential units were raided, resulting in the detection of five unlicensed massage establishments. A total of 16 women were arrested for offences under the Women’s Charter 1961.

Public Entertainment, Foreign Manpower Act, Customs and Fire Safety

In another operation against public entertainment outlets, two outlets along Koek Road and Cuscaden Road were found to have committed breaches under the Public Entertainment Act 1958, while one outlet along Koek Road was found to have committed an offence under the COVID-19 (Temporary Measures) Act 2020.

A joint enforcement operation with the Ministry of Manpower, Urban Redevelopment Authority, Singapore Customs and the Singapore Civil Defence Force, was also carried out at a unit along Grange Road, where 26 occupants were found to be residing in the unit.

The respective agencies have commenced investigations into breaches under the Employment of Foreign Manpower Act 1990, the Planning Act 1998, the Fire Safety Act 1993, as well as the Customs Act 1960.
